Sage Coffee Machines

Sage coffee machines come with a built-in burr grinder with a dial for adjusting the amount of ground beans. The beans are then dispersed directly into the portafilter. They also come with an infusion system that is low pressure and a 9 bar extraction system to guarantee the best espresso flavor every time.

Duo Temp Pro

The Sage Duo Temp Pro is an excellent machine for those who wish to prepare third wave specialty coffee at home. This espresso maker features a low-pressure pre-infusion system that guarantees even extraction and a balanced taste. It also has an tamper that allows you to easily apply the proper amount of pressure when putting ground coffee machine comparison in the portafilter. It comes with a convenient maintenance indicator that lets you know when it is time to clean your machine.

The Duo Temp Pro has a number of outstanding features that set it apart from other espresso machines available on the market. The automatic purge feature helps keep the water temperature constant throughout the brewing process. The stainless steel tank is also constructed to last. It is equipped with a 1600W thermocoil heating system that lets you take advantage of the highest quality espresso every time.
